3N58
Crystal structure of S-ADENOSYL-L-HOMOCYSTEINE hydrolase from brucella melitensis in ternary complex with NAD and adenosine, orthorhombic form
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| ALS BEAMLINE 5.0.1 |
Synchrotron site | ALS |
Beamline | 5.0.1 |
Temperature [K] | 100 |
Detector technology | CCD |
Collection date | 2010-04-30 |
Detector | ADSC QUANTUM 210 |
Wavelength(s) | 0.97740 |
Spacegroup name | P 21 21 21 |
Unit cell lengths | 68.450, 165.230, 184.140 |
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
Resolution | 49.270 - 2.390 |
R-factor | 0.175 |
Rwork | 0.172 |
R-free | 0.23500 |
Starting model (for MR) | 2ziz |
RMSD bond length | 0.008 |
RMSD bond angle | 1.192 |
Data reduction software | XDS |
Data scaling software | XSCALE |
Phasing software | PHASER |
Refinement software | PHENIX ((PHENIX.REFINE: 1.6.1_357))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 49.270 | 2.450 |
High resolution limit [Å] | 2.390 | 2.390 |
Rmerge | 0.109 | 0.522 |
Number of reflections | 83542 | |
<I/σ(I)> | 16.09 | 3.6 |
Completeness [%] | 100.0 | 100 |
Redundancy | 7.7 | 7 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 8 | 290 | JCSG SCREEN CONDITION D12: 20% V/ V GLYCEROL, 16% W/V PEG 8000, 40 MM POTASSIUM PHOSPHATE, PROTEIN AT 80 MG/ML, VAPOR DIFFUSION, SITTING DROP, TEMPERATURE 290K, pH 8.0 |
